/*
|
|
*
|
|
* This routine installs an interrupt vector using the basic
|
|
* RTEMS mechanisms. This implementation should be suitable for
|
|
* most m68k based boards. However, if the board has an unusual
|
|
* interrupt controller or most somehow manipulate board specific
|
|
* hardware to enable/disable, mask, prioritize, etc an interrupt
|
|
* source, then this routine should be customized to support that.
|
|
*
|
|
* COPYRIGHT (c) 1989-1997. 1997.
|
|
* On-Line Applications Research Corporation (OAR).
|
|
* Copyright assigned to U.S. Government, 1994.
|
|
*
|
|
* The license and distribution terms for this file may in
|
|
* the file LICENSE in this distribution or at
|
|
* http://www.OARcorp.com/rtems/license.html.
|
|
*
|
|
* $Id$
|
|
*/
|
|
|
|
#include <rtems.h>
|
|
#include <bsp.h>
|
|
|
|
m68k_isr_entry set_vector( /* returns old vector */
|
|
rtems_isr_entry handler, /* isr routine */
|
|
rtems_vector_number vector, /* vector number */
|
|
int type /* RTEMS or RAW intr */
|
|
)
|
|
{
|
|
m68k_isr_entry previous_isr;
|
|
|
|
if ( type )
|
|
rtems_interrupt_catch( handler, vector, (rtems_isr_entry *) &previous_isr );
|
|
else {
|
|
_CPU_ISR_install_raw_handler( vector, handler, (void *)&previous_isr );
|
|
}
|
|
return previous_isr;
|
|
}
